Revenue or income, minus departmental expenses and undistributed expenses equals:

Business
1 answer:
mixer [17]3 years ago
8 0
Departmental income can be considered the contribution of revenues to profits because it is computed after deducting the direct costs of providing the service or product. Subtracting all of the undistributed operating expenses from total revenues results in gross operating profit per available room (GOPPAR).

Vroom's current formulation includes two different decision trees. one tree is to be used when the manager is primarily interest
SVETLANKA909090 [29]

Helping their employees develop their own decision-making approach.

The two trees are time-driven decisions and development-driven decisions. Sometimes managers just have to take the lead and make a decision quickly and effectively, but in other situations they can take more time and focus on training and developing their employees into effective decision makers.
